Output bf8a26490cceabc98623078bf2ba65bc31cf176796957825a4a3bdc261e27595:0
- value
- 2500937
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 611aff69e20cf8039771b718670733ada54c8be6 OP_EQUAL
- address
- 3AYToz5vaXi64iSwyDDHEev7Wps3HUA93b
- transaction
- bf8a26490cceabc98623078bf2ba65bc31cf176796957825a4a3bdc261e27595
- confirmations
- 157980
- spent
- true